Manika Gram Panchayat, Teonthar
Manika is a Gram Panchayat located in the Rewa district of Madhya Pradesh. It falls under the Teonthar Janpad Panchayat and Rewa Zila Panchayat. Manika Gram Panchayat covers a total of 5 villages, including Baretitir, Bijhwar, and Lohsain. It is headed by an elected Sarpanch, while administrative work is handled by the Panchayat Secretary.
List of Villages in Manika Gram Panchayat
Manika Gram Panchayat covers the following villages.
| Sl. No. | Village |
|---|---|
| 1 | Baretitir |
| 2 | Bijhwar |
| 3 | Lohsain |
| 4 | Manika |
| 5 | Sutipur |
Panchayati Raj Structure for Manika Gram Panchayat
Manika Gram Panchayat is part of Madhya Pradesh's three-tier Panchayati Raj structure. The three levels are described below.
Tier 1: Gram Panchayat (GP)
Manika Gram Panchayat is the village-level Panchayati Raj institution. It handles local development and basic civic services such as drinking water, sanitation, street lighting and village infrastructure.
Tier 2: Block Panchayat (BP)
Teonthar Janpad Panchayat is the intermediate-level Panchayati Raj institution for Manika Gram Panchayat. It coordinates development activities across Gram Panchayats in its area.
Tier 3: District Panchayat (DP)
Rewa Zila Panchayat is the district-level Panchayati Raj institution for Manika Gram Panchayat. It coordinates development planning and activities at the district level.
